Transaction f6220107c6e3dd97dbacbd128af35a64ccc7aaa04fe276ba60ed81d7c41fbc00

34 Input
2 Outputs
  • f6220107c6e3dd97dbacbd128af35a64ccc7aaa04fe276ba60ed81d7c41fbc00:0
  • value  182449729
    address  1M8t75h86xyFN5hQSDYM4g6EdmXFCALo4Z
  • f6220107c6e3dd97dbacbd128af35a64ccc7aaa04fe276ba60ed81d7c41fbc00:1
  • value  669166
    address  1M7ED3gePwU8bKTcDE7q5qWZVKUM2xMiGD